This is due to one main reason, in which 'lawofonesociety.com' offers a unique way for people/seekers to meet up using an interactive 'seeker map' on the site. Many times in the meet up area (Bring4th), I've seen countless shouts/request/questions like... "Anyone in the Central Florida area?", "Colorado meet-up?".
What our site offers is the ability for users/seekers to mark their preferred area on the map (using social networking tools), and be able to create a group that can meet up in person to discuss the Law of One. For example, I live in Croydon, United Kingdom, and any seeker (wherever he/she may be) can simply search that particular area, my profile will pop-up on the interactive map, with direct link to my profile. If I already have a group created, the person searching can simply join it and get notified if/when there's any meeting taking place. We feel this is a lot more robust, with its 'visual interactive map' overview and quicker tools to arrange meetings with like-minded individuals.
